AcademicsCameron University includes the following academic
divisions:
- Graduate Studies
- School of Business
- School of Education & Behavioral Sciences
- School of Liberal Arts
- School of Science and Technology
- Allied Health and Interdisciplinary Studies

AccreditationThe university is accredited by The Higher Learning Commission, a Commission of The North Central Association of Colleges and Schools.
Different degree programs at Cameron University have also received accreditation from:
- Association of Collegiate Business Schools and Programs (ACBSP)
- Oklahoma Commission for Teacher Preparation
- National Council for the Accreditation of Teacher Education (NCATE)
- National Association of Schools of Music
- American Design Drafting Association
- National Accrediting Agency for Clinical Laboratory Sciences (NAACLS)
- Commission on Accreditation of Allied Health Education Program
